> I would recommend looking at the ddwrt website for compatible routers..
> There are several open source firmwares for wireless routers and they are
> all far better then the manufacturers firmware. I sure there are others on
> the list that have their favorites, and I hope they chime in. I just think
> ddwrt is a good place to start.
